[PATCH v3 iproute2] bridge: add support for L2 multicast groups

From: Vladimir Oltean
Date: Wed Nov 25 2020 - 09:36:57 EST


Extend the 'bridge mdb' command for the following syntax:
bridge mdb add dev br0 port swp0 grp 01:02:03:04:05:06 permanent

Signed-off-by: Vladimir Oltean <vladimir.oltean@xxxxxxx>
---
Changes in v3:
- Using rt_addr_n2a_r instead of inet_ntop/ll_addr_n2a directly.
- Updated the bridge manpage.

Changes in v2:
- Removed the const void casts.
- Removed MDB_FLAGS_L2 from the UAPI to be in sync with the latest
kernel patch:
